Ticket PR-2291: The Ledgerhawk payroll export switched from fixed-width to CSV on Monday, and the nightly job now fails validation against the old schema. Finance at Corvane Group needs the corrected export by Thursday. The schema mapping lives in the payroll-formats vault, which auto-locked after three failed attempts by the deploy bot. Update the parser config, regenerate the export, and confirm checksums match. To unlock the vault and retrieve the mapping file, enter the recovery passphrase below.

vault phrase of yagag-yafof = belael-weniel-kasion-silath-jorax-pelox-silir-soreth-ralmir

Q: How does Mosswright sandbox user-supplied formulas, and what should I poke at first?

A: Formulas compile to a restricted bytecode and run in the Thistle VM—no I/O, no eval, hard caps on recursion and memory. The fun attack surface is the builtin bridge, so start your review there. If you want to replay flagged formulas from quarantine, the replay vault needs unlocking, using the passphrase given below.

unlock words, hahip-baduf: holwyn-istath-julvan

## Deployment

Dedupe Sentinel, our on-call alert deduplicator, ships as a single container and must be rolled out to the Norrfield cluster before the paging bridge restarts. Verify the suppression window matches what the incident leads approved, since a mismatch silently drops alerts. The deployment reads the following configuration values at startup.

service settings:
[casax]
port = 6379
team = rusir
host = casax.zemvarhq.corp
region = outer-4
access_code = ac_9808ce
timeout_ms = 1500

Hello plugin authors,

Next Thursday, Corbexa will run a disaster-recovery drill for the RestockRoute vending-machine restock planner. During the failover window, plugin callbacks will be replayed against the standby scheduler, so please ensure your handlers are idempotent and tolerate duplicate route assignments. No customer restock data will be altered. To re-register your plugin against the standby environment during the drill, authenticate with the recovery passphrase provided below.

vault phrase of hahip-tajeg = quenax-briath-briax